Hidden Valley Trail

A power-hike climb in Utah. The hardest 500 metres average 24.9% and start 1.3 km in, in the middle of the climb, so pace the first part. Northwest-facing, so it stays cool and holds snow late. Most runners need 33 to 56 minutes. At 9.5 TEP it is harder than 78% of the climbs in the catalogue. Mostly on trail.
